Frequently asked questions

What should a wedding photo collection app do well?

It should make uploads easy for guests, keep the gallery organized for hosts, and make the final archive simple to download after the event.

Why collect wedding photos during the event instead of later?

Because the best candid shots are easiest to share while the celebration is still happening. Later requests are easier to ignore and easier to forget.
